        I have a fiberglass shower pan that I’m trying to remove. It appears to be being held in place by the drain flange. Is there an easy way to remove the drain?

      • #291207
        Avatar photoGuest
        Participant

          1- Get a hammer ands chisel and make a hole a few inches from the 2″ drain pipe.

          2- Get a reciprocating saw and cut all around the drain opening be careful NOT to cut the pipe and cut out the base only.

          3- after you make a circle around the drain opening you can then remove some tiles near the top of this pan and take the pan out.

          4- Now all you do is take the reciprocating saw and cut off GENTLY the last little piece of this drain connection

          You may want to put a rag in this drain pipe to prevent debris from going in.
